10:32 ET - Labor disputes are challenging the big air-cargo ramp by Amazon ( AMZN) , with Air Transport (ATSG) and Atlas Air (AAWW) both battling strife in their pilot ranks while frantically hiring to keep up. ATSG officials say their 3Q conference call that some pilots have stopped volunteering for extra work, just as the peak season looms--forcing it to pay premium rates to maintain service levels. It's also taken the Teamsters to court, alleging it violated labor agreements by advising pilots not to work extra flights, a charge the union contests. ATSG will have 3 more Boeing (BA) 767s flying for AMZN during the peak season. Amid its noted revenue beat, ATSG rises 3.2% to $13.38, turning positive for the week. (
